From baa1cbab47326656f762562303ddf4b0d9cc2b5c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ross Burton Date: Mon, 24 Mar 2025 17:20:07 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] attr: improve ptest packaging As there's just a few test binaries in attr, instead of installing large chunks of the build tree we can install just those and use a boilerplate test runner. Also add a comment explaining why we have to sed the test suite if musl is used.
